Thursday 23rd Feb 7.30pm |
The SpArC Theatre Bishop's Castle.
Caroline Horton presents: January 1945, Paris is liberated. Christiane waits in Gare Du Nord for a ticket to England where she will be reunited her with her fiance. Whilst she waits, this gloriously irrepressible Mademoiselle recounts the extraordinary love story between her, an eccentric, acutely myopic Parisienne and a tongue-tied teacher from Staffordshire. From a chance encounter at Cheadle tennis club, their story takes us on to cosmopolitan 1930s Paris before their inevitable separation by war. A fond, comical and ultimately poignant portrait of one woman's experience of love and war. £8 adults/£5
children |

Saturday 5th May 10.30am - 3.30pm |
Bury Ditches Wood White Butterfly Survey. Wood White Butterfly survey in the woods around Clun. Come and help us find one of England’s rarest butterflies. Meet at Bury Ditches car park (Grid reference SO334840). Contact Nick Williams to book 0121 550 9853 (children 8yrs + welcome if accompanied by an adult). Event arranged by Butterfly Conservation and Kemp Valley Community Wildlife Group. |
